A wheel 2.20 m in diameter lies in a vertical plane and rotates about its central axis with a constant angular acceleration of 4.45 rad/s2. The wheel starts at rest at t = 0, and the radius vector of a certain point P on the rim makes an angle of 57.3° with the horizontal at this time. At t = 2.00 s, find the following.
